Membuat Tag Pre Converter - Hai sobat Blogger kali ini saya akan membagikan sedikit tool yang berada di blog ini yaitu Tag Pre Converter.
Tool ini sangat cocok buat para sobat blogger yang suka berbagi tutorial blog, lebih tepatnya cocok buat sobat yang memakai Syntax Highlighter dengan input kode seperti <code>Kode Disini</code>.
Untuk menggunakanya masukan kode ini dipage blog.
1. Login Blogger
2. Masuk Page / Laman dan masukan kode ini di bagian
<style scoped="" type="text/css">
code{font-family:Consolas,Monaco,'Andale Mono','Courier New',Courier,Monospace;color:#2a5ead;font-size:13px;padding:2px 4px;color:#d14;background-color:#f7f7f9;border:1px solid #ddd}
#codes{border:none;width:98%;height:200px;margin:0 auto;display:block;background-color:#F0F0F0;padding:5px;font:normal 12px 'Courier New',Monospace;border:1px solid #ccc}
#codes:focus{background-color:#FFF;color:#303030}
.button-group{margin:0 auto 0;text-align:center}
button,button[disabled]:active{text-align:center;color:#fff; display:inline-block; white-space:nowrap; background-color:#00aaff;background: linear-gradient(#00aaff,#0994d9); border-radius:2px 2px 2px 2px; cursor:pointer; font-family:Coda; font-size:14px; padding:3px 8px 1px; position:relative; text-shadow:0 1px 0 rgba(0,0,0,0.3); top:-1px; transition:none 0s ease 0s; border:1px solid #888;box-shadow: inset 0px 1px 0px rgba(255,255,255,0.3), 0px 1px 2px #bbb;}
button:active{background: linear-gradient(#0994d9,#00aaff)}
button[disabled],button[disabled]:active{background: #00aaff;top:0; box-shadow:inset 0 2px 0 rgba(255,255,255,0); }
#opt1,#opt2,#opt3,#opt4,#opt5{display:inline-block;margin:0 10px 0 0;vertical-align:middle;border:none;outline:none}
</style><textarea id="codes" placeholder="Tulis/paste kode di sini lalu klik 'Konversi'" spellcheck="false"></textarea>
<br />
<div class="button-group">
<button id="cvrt" onclick="cdConvert();this.disabled = true;">Konversi</button><button onclick="cdClear();">Bersihkan</button>
<br />
<div style="text-align: left;">
<br /></div>
</div>
<input checked="true" id="opt1" type="checkbox" />Konversi <code>&</code> menjadi <code>&amp;</code>
<br />
<input id="opt2" type="checkbox" />Konversi <code>'</code> menjadi <code>&#039;</code>
<br />
<input id="opt3" type="checkbox" />Konversi <code>"</code> menjadi <code>&quot;</code>
<br />
<input checked="true" id="opt4" type="checkbox" />Konversi <code><</code> menjadi <code>&lt;</code>
<br />
<input checked="true" id="opt5" type="checkbox" />Konversi <code>></code> menjadi <code>&gt;</code>
<br />
<script type="text/javascript">
function cdClear() {
var wtarea = document.getElementById('codes');
wtarea.value = '';
wtarea.focus();
document.getElementById('cvrt').disabled = false;
}
function cdConvert() {
var ctarea = document.getElementById('codes'),
cv = ctarea.value,
opt1 = document.getElementById('opt1'),
opt2 = document.getElementById('opt2'),
opt3 = document.getElementById('opt3'),
opt4 = document.getElementById('opt4'),
opt5 = document.getElementById('opt5');
cv = cv.replace(/\t/g, " ");
if (opt1.checked) cv = cv.replace(/&/g, "&amp;");
if (opt2.checked) cv = cv.replace(/'/g, "&#039;");
if (opt3.checked) cv = cv.replace(/"/g, "&quot;");
if (opt4.checked) cv = cv.replace(/</g, "&lt;");
if (opt5.checked) cv = cv.replace(/>/g, "&gt;");
if (cv.lastIndexOf('\n') != -1 || cv.length > 40) {
cv = cv.replace(/^/, "<\pre\><\code\>");
cv = cv.replace(/$/, "</code></pre>
");
}
else {
cv = cv.replace(/^/, "<\code\>");
cv = cv.replace(/$/, "</code>");
}
ctarea.value = cv;
ctarea.focus();
ctarea.select();
};
</script>3. Simpan dan lihat hasilnya!
Artikel ini berasal dari :
http://kang-ugnazi.blogspot.co.id/2015/08/membuat-tag-pre-converter.html
http://kang-ugnazi.blogspot.co.id/2015/08/membuat-tag-pre-converter.html

Tidak ada komentar
Suwandy Berpesan :
1. Berkomentarlah dengan baik dan sopan
2. Saya akan selalu melihat setiap komentar, tetapi tidak semuanya saya jawab
3. Terimah kasih -_-